Learn more about Futaba

Devastated by the 2011 nuclear disaster, this coastal town invites reflection at the Great East Japan Earthquake and Nuclear Disaster Memorial Museum. Cherry blossoms at Yonomori Park offer seasonal beauty while nearby J-Village Stadium and Minamisoma City Museum provide cultural context to this recovering region.

Best time to go to Futaba

The best time to visit Futaba can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Futaba falls in August,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with moderate rain. The coolest average temperature in Futaba fal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January36.7°F (2.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
February37.2°F (2.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
March43.3°F (6.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
April51.4°F (10.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May61.2°F (16.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
June67.5°F (19.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
July74.8°F (23.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
August77.2°F (25.1°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
September70.7°F (21.5°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
October60.8°F (16.0°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November51.4°F (10.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
December41.7°F (5.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Futaba

Traveling to Futaba, Fukushima Prefecture, is convenient with two major airports. Sendai Airport (SDJ) is situated 77.2km away and is served by multiple airlines, with notable hotels nearby such as The Westin Sendai, Hotel Metropolitan Sendai East, and Hotel Metropolitan Sendai, all approximately 14.5km from the airport. Alternatively, Fukushima Airport (FKS) is 56.3km from Futaba, offering closer accommodations like Hotel Wing International Sukagawa, Kanazawa Sky Hotel, and Koriyama View Hotel Annex, located 5, 6, and 19.3km from the airport, respectively. Both airports provide various transportation options to reach Futaba comfortably.
